#Pound University

Join #university and get schooled in tf2.

This steam group is the recruitment bed for future #u teams. Our goal is to build teams from the ground up so that the competitive TF2 community can benefit from the vast amounts of skilled public gamers currently playing TF2.

Most of us are located on the gamesurge IRC network in channel #pound.

Team #pound (which is the mentor team for #u teams) has been very successful in the 8v8 format for team fortress 2. Most of #pound's members at one point in their online careers became familiar with competitive gaming because someone approached them on the subject from a public gaming server. For most of us this didn't happen when we started playing TF2 but rather another older game we had previously played. Our members noticed how immensely popular TF2 has become to the average public player, so we decided that the TF2 community needed an outreach program to bring in new competitive players from the wealth of public TF2 servers.

The TF2 competitive community has grown a lot over the last year, the 6v6 format has become a strong top tier format. This group’s goals are to help transition players from public servers to competitive TF2 by introducing them to the 8v8 format. The 8v8 format is generally thought of as a more causal format from 6v6 so it is the perfect format for introducing new competitive players.

One of the major problems with TF2's competitive community is that the learning curve on team work and strategy for new teams is enough to stymie any new team’s interest in the game. Our contribution to the solution of this problem is that #pound will build a sister team so that they might learn from our success and experience in competitive match play. The end goal is to produce a stable team of players who may not be familiar with the tf2 competitive community, but eventually their team will break away from #pound to become their own stand alone team. At this point #pound will be able to recreate the process with another team of players. This project is called #university (#u).
